Be Aware of the Working Environment
Avoid long-term operation
in very hot or very cold
weather.
Always make sure the ap-
propriate cutting attachment
shield is correctly installed.
Be extremely careful
of slippery terrain,
especially during rainy
weather.
Be constantly alert for objects
and debris that could be thrown
either from the rotating cutting
attachment or bounced from a
hard surface.

Safety and Operation Information
Labels: Make sure all information
labels are undamaged and readable.
Immediately replace damaged or miss-
ing information labels. New labels are
available from your local authorized
Shindaiwa dealer.
